Image Quality I Can Expect

One of the biggest reasons I would buy the RX100 II is its image quality. I appreciate that it uses a large 1-inch sensor, which helps me get sharper photos with better detail than most small compact cameras. In my experience, this kind of sensor makes a noticeable difference in daylight and also helps reduce noise when I shoot in lower light.

Low-Light Performance

If I plan to shoot indoors, at night, or in dim conditions, low-light performance becomes very important to me. The RX100 II does well here because of its bright lens and sensor combination. I find this useful when I want to capture moments without always relying on flash. It gives me more flexibility in real-world shooting situations.

Portability and Build Quality

What I really like about the RX100 II is how easy it is to carry. I prefer a camera that I can slip into a jacket pocket or small bag without any trouble. The build feels solid and premium, which gives me confidence that it can handle regular use. For me, a compact camera should be convenient without feeling cheap, and this one fits that idea well.

Features That Matter to Me

When I buy a camera, I want useful features, not just extras that sound nice on paper. The tilting screen is helpful when I want to shoot from different angles or take selfies. Wi-Fi support is useful when I want to transfer images quickly. I also value manual controls because they let me have more creative control over exposure and settings.
